DigiLAC es una plataforma virtual creada por el BID para cerrar las brechas existentes en la penetración de banda ancha y consolidar, a través de índices de desarrollo digital innovadores, mapas e informes de infraestructura, información clave sobre los desafíos, oportunidades y posibilidades de desarrollo de banda ancha en América Latina y el Caribe (LAC).

The main goal of the IDBA is to size the Digital Divide in Latin America and the Caribbean by measuring the state of broadband development in the 26 Bank-member countries, as well as in additional reference countries (64 nations in total). The IDBA is a powerful tool to identify the magnitude of the gap in two different geographic approached, first when we compare the state of the art of one country versus the cluster region the country belongs to, and second, when we compare the country with respect to the OECD. The IDBA relies on a comprehensive approach based on four pillars: infrastructure, applications and capacity, strategic regulations, and public policy and strategic vision. Those four pillars are built as a result of the combination of 37 indicators from renowned international institutions. As a result, the IDBA provides a tool for decision makers and policymakers to detect, on a country basis, strengths and areas for improvement in developing specific, concrete and actionable plans.
